I've decided that my middle class home in the Chicago suburbs is way too expensive per month and that I work I job that I can't stand to pay my mortgage and ridiculous bills. I've also decided that I will, in the near future, solve this problem by finding a MH in a MH community on the Florida shore (don't really care which part of Florida - just trying to find the right purchase price). I've been researching possibilities for some time now, and find that the pricerange on these MH's is very large. For example, I've seen an ad for a 1999 Redman already placed in a community that is 32' x 52` for $21,995. From my perspective, this is a fabulous deal. I've also seen ads for smaller MH's in similar locations for $75,000. Since I'm looking to buy, not finance, my MH and also afford the move out of the midwest and time to find another job, I really like the sound of the 1999 Redman for $21,995. What is the usual land rental price for a small lot? Do you pay taxes on the MH if you rent the land? Are utilities fairly inexpensive as well for a MH, or just the same as any other house depending on square footage? What is the yearly "tag" fee for a MH in Florida? Is it unreasonable to try and find a MH that has 1300-1600 square feet near the beach for under $25K? Any help you all can provide is much appreciated. Thanks!
